      <title>A Little Lunch Music 2012 @ City Recital Hall Angel Place Sydney - Monday, 20 February 2012</title>
      <description>City Recital Hall Angel Place and Kathryn Selby present the popular A Little Lunch Music series – diverse monthly concerts featuring some of Australia’s finest musicians
Monday 20 February to Friday 14 December 2012 
City Recital Hall Angel Place 

A Little Lunch Music 2012 is a series of spectacular 50-minute monthly concerts from Monday 20 February until Friday 14 December.
Showcasing magnificent music and esteemed artists, A Little Lunch Music 2012 is an opportunity to relax and go behind the music with some of Australia’s finest musicians including multi-award winning cellist Clancy Newman, internationally acclaimed classical accordionist James Crabb, the popular Matt Keegan Trio jazz group, Principal Cello of the Australian Chamber Orchestra Timo-Veikko Valve, Principal Viola of the Sydney Symphony Tobias Breider, and former BBC Scottish Concertmaster Elizabeth Layton. 
Each month City Recital Hall Angel Place and Selby &amp; Friends present a new concert with a different set of works and new artists for only $15 a ticket. 
All concerts commence at 12.30pm.  
A Little Lunch Music 2012
Monday 20 February: Clancy Newman &amp; Kathryn Selby. Multi award-winning cellist Clancy Newman returns with series Artistic Director Kathryn Selby for a showcase of cello/piano duos.
Tuesday 20 March: Gerard Willems &amp; Beethoven. Beethoven specialist Gerard Willems explores the mysteries of the “Appassionata”.
Thursday 26 April: James Crabb. An introduction to the classical accordion and its amazing sound, demonstrated with a diverse repertoire from the Baroque period to the 21st Century. 
Monday 28 May: Brahms Piano Quartet in G Minor Elizabeth Layton (violin), Tobias Breider (viola), Timo-Veikko Valve (cello) &amp; Kathryn Selby (piano). An exploration of this masterwork by four of our most impressive musicians. 
Tuesday 12 June: New Sydney Wind Quintet &amp; Kathryn Selby. Leading members of Sydney Symphony form Australia’s premiere wind quintet and present a gorgeous program of favourites with Kathryn Selby.
Tuesday 17 July: Emerging Artists (formerly Rising Stars). A wonderful opportunity to be inspired by outstanding stars of the future.
Friday 31 August: Matt Keegan Trio combines three of Sydney’s most popular and talented jazz musicians who will perform a stunning program of engaging original music from a diverse range of musical influences.
Tuesday 18 September: Sydney University Symphony Orchestra presents a joyous program of Mozart with Kathryn Selby.
Thursday 4 October: Flinders Quartet. Schubert’s glorious string quartet “Death and the Maiden” is highlighted by this dynamic ensemble from Melbourne.	
Wednesday 14 November: Ensemble Offspring. Fusing clarinet, bass clarinet, marimba, claves and voice this eclectic and appealing program features works by much loved Australian composers Ross Edwards, Elena Kats-Chernin and Andrew Ford. 
Friday 14 December: Dr V’s Swing Thing returns for a special Christmas spin on jazz favourites!

      <title>Diego Guerrero y el Solar de Artistas @ City Recital Hall Angel Place Sydney - Friday, 9 March 2012</title>
      <description>Flamenco vocal sensation Diego Guerrero and Madrid-based band El Solar de Artistas make their Australian performance debut at City Recital Hall Angel Place 
Friday 9 March 2012 

In their first Australian performance together, international vocal musician Diego Guerrero and his extraordinary Latin flamenco band El Solar de Artistas will captivate at Sydney’s City Recital Hall Angel Place on Friday 9 March at 8pm when they perform a wonderfully diverse concert that traverses the genres of guaguanco, bulería, tango, copla and rumba flamenca. 

Diego Guerrero y el Solar de Artistas are a fast rising force on the international music scene, with Guerrero recently described as the “Quincy Jones of flamenco”. At just 29 years of age, this talented young flamenco vocalist is also making a name for himself as a gifted arranger and composer.

Formed in 2010 by Diego Guerrero and his percussionist wife Nasrine Rahmani, El Solar de Artistas is an elite selection of flamenco and Latin musicians residing in Spain who fuse traditional flamenco with Afro-Cuban rhythms and contemporary jazz. 

In 2010 Diego Guerrero and an Australian line-up, Diego Guerrero Flamenco Latin Quintet, completed two sold-out tours of Australia which included two concerts in Sydney. In 2012 Guerrero brings his Madrid-based line-up to Australia for the first time. 

Some of the entrancing tunes on the program include Primavera, a gorgeous ballad by one of Guerrero’s favourite singers and good friend Alex Oliveira, and Malos Tiempos which Nasrine Rahmani said “is probably Diego’s theme song.”

Another crowd pleaser, according to Nasrine, is A Farina. 

“A Farina is a huge crowd favourite,” said Nasrine. 

“It’s actually a bit of a mystery to us, but everywhere in the world, regardless of the language or culture, it’s always a favourite.”

Diego Guerrero y el Solar de Artistas will perform at City Recital Hall Angel Place for one night only on Friday 9 March at 8pm.

      <title>Jane Birkin Sings Serge Gainsbourg @ City Recital Hall Angel Place Sydney - Friday, 16 March 2012</title>
      <description>Jane Birkin Sings Serge Gainsbourg at City Recital Hall Angel Place for one night only on her 2012 Australian national tour
Friday 16 March, 8.00pm
City Recital Hall Angel Place 

Jane Birkin is one of the world’s most iconic and celebrated women. The star of film and stage, singer, songwriter and darling of the French avant garde Jane Birkin will perform at City Recital Hall Angel Place for one night only during her Australian tour in March 2012. 

In a powerful homage to her partner and mentor Serge Gainsbourg, the style icon presents a special concert of Gainsbourg’s music to mark 20 years since his death.

For more than a decade Jane Birkin was muse to the legendary French singer, songwriter and enfant terrible Gainsbourg. Together they produced six albums and continued to collaborate professionally long after their relationship ended in 1980.

Birkin will perform with a group comprising some of Japan’s finest musicians including pianist and composer Nobuyuki Nakajima known for both his masterful piano and his work arranging ensembles, jazz-influenced drummer Tsuotmu Kurihara, violinist Asuka Maret, and brass player Shuishiro Sakaguchi.

In her long career, Jane Birkin has starred in countless films, released dozens of recordings and since the late 1990s has performed her interpretations of Serge Gainsbourg’s repertoire to sell-out houses around the world.
